Transaction 1667d186c4a858dabbdde410d99edb9a1ea2cea69fb8f443275cc15506ae87a9
1 Input
1 Output
-
1667d186c4a858dabbdde410d99edb9a1ea2cea69fb8f443275cc15506ae87a9:0
- value
- 343429600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4087373ec5b566fc373dd7da1a1559c612c427b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LL8NrUMzrxH2W3XL42JHQxvMQ3XTcoDsM